Key Responsibilities for this Pharmacovigilance Job
- Identify and create ICSR cases in the global safety database
- Triage and prioritize serious and non-serious adverse event cases
- Perform data entry, case processing, and follow-ups as per SOPs
- Code adverse events, medical history, and suspect drugs using MedDRA and WHO-Drug
- Draft case narratives and sender comments
- Process AE, SAE, and SUSAR submissions within regulatory timelines
- Perform duplicate checks and validate case data accuracy
- Request and track missing safety information
- Monitor and reconcile safety intake sources and mailboxes
- Support audits, inspections, and ad-hoc pharmacovigilance projects
- Perform translations and unblinding activities as per SOPs
- Ensure compliance with global regulatory and quality standards
Skills Required for this Pharmacovigilance Job
- Knowledge of pharmacovigilance operations
- Understanding of medical terminology
- Familiarity with MedDRA and WHO-Drug
- Safety database exposure preferred
- Strong medical writing and documentation skills
- Good communication and English language proficiency
- Attention to detail and ability to meet regulatory timelines
- Basic proficiency in MS Office tools
